Now I can access my blogspot account. Recently, the semiconductors market has changed a lot. After Huawei has been blacklisted, more and more chips are not allowed to sell to China anymore. Since the supply chain has been blocked for over two years, a lot of Chinese semiconductors companies stared their IPO and more products are released to the market as well as other areas, there chips include the following sectors:

  • Memory: NOR/NAND flash, SSD, DRAM, SRAM, MRAM, EEPROM
  • CPU: CPU for desktop, server, thin-server, gateway
  • SoC: SoC for mobile, camera, TV and consumer video/audio, router and etc
  • MCU: MIPS/ARM/RISC-V/8051 based MCU
  • FPGA: entry level FPGA and CPLD
  • NPU: standard alone APU or embedded NPU IP
  • Logic: standard logic
  • Discrete: power, IGBT and RF
  • IP: EDA, IP vendors

Market Trend

I had worked for Philips/NXP semiconductors for 15 years. I know if the margin of a chip is lower than 30%, most of the semiconductors will consider to spin off the product line. However in China, the chips are getting more and more cheaper with relatively worse performance. As time goes by, more and more market share is acquired by Chinese suppliers. For example, broadcom, TI and cypress used to have embedded SoC PL for WiFi chip, but after expressif released ESP8266/ESP32 with mature software framework, almost 90% share belongs to expressif due to one reason, price. Now ESP8266/ESP32 becomes a de facto interface to IoT device.

Cons and Pros

However, due to cost consideration, most of the chips have compromise, compare to the top suppliers. For example, they use XIP flash, instead of embedded flash. The approach changes a lot in debugging, programming, security and software architecture.
